Vijay Shankar is a scholar working on Environmental Engineering, Soil Science and Civil and Structural Engineering. According to data from OpenAlex, Vijay Shankar has authored 87 papers receiving a total of 903 indexed citations (citations by other indexed papers that have themselves been cited), including 44 papers in Environmental Engineering, 30 papers in Soil Science and 27 papers in Civil and Structural Engineering. Recurrent topics in Vijay Shankar's work include Irrigation Practices and Water Management (30 papers), Soil and Unsaturated Flow (24 papers) and Soil Moisture and Remote Sensing (18 papers). Vijay Shankar is often cited by papers focused on Irrigation Practices and Water Management (30 papers), Soil and Unsaturated Flow (24 papers) and Soil Moisture and Remote Sensing (18 papers). Vijay Shankar collaborates with scholars based in India, Sweden and United Kingdom. Vijay Shankar's co-authors include Mahesh Kumar Jat, Rohitashw Kumar, Navsal Kumar, C. S. P. Ojha, Arunava Poddar, Adebayo J. Adeloye, Laila Hussein, Rabee Rustum, Jessica Moncivaiz and Nicholas V. Reo and has published in prestigious journals such as SHILAP Revista de lepidopterología, Ecological Modelling and Ultrasonics Sonochemistry.
